Page 1 of 1

Problemas con nuevas versiones de xHarbour y BCC

PostPosted: Sat Mar 23, 2024 12:25 pm
by Enrrique Vertiz
Saludos Estimados

Tengo algunos probemas al querer utilizar las nuevas versiones, ya sea de xHb o de C, primero el problema del xHb, indicare abajo hasta donde funciono Ok y desde donde empiezan los problemas:

Funciona OK: FWH 24.02, xHarbour 1.2.3.10264, BCC 7.4

Da error: FWH 24.02, xHarbour 1.2.3.10279, BCC 7.4 (el error aqui abajo)

Executando: ILINK32 @B32.BC
Turbo Incremental Link 6.90 Copyright (c) 1997-2017 Embarcadero Technologies, Inc.
Error: Unresolved external '_dv_memcpy' referenced from D:\XHB\XHRB123_10279\LIB\SQLLIB_XHB_123.LIB|sqllib_api
Error: Unable to perform link

Mismo FWH, mismo BCC, diferente version de xHb, debo indicar que esa lib, en la que muestra el error pertenece a SQLLIB, libreria que uso en muchas versiones anteriores de xHb, BCC y FWH sin ningun problema, hasta el indicado ... gracias por la atencion.

Re: Problemas con nuevas versiones de xHarbour y BCC

PostPosted: Sat Mar 23, 2024 2:53 pm
by Enrico Maria Giordano
What is SQLLIB_XHB_123.LIB? It is not a xHarbour library.

Re: Problemas con nuevas versiones de xHarbour y BCC

PostPosted: Sat Mar 23, 2024 3:39 pm
by Enrrique Vertiz
Saludos Enrico

No es una LIB de xHb, es una LIB de terceros, que no reporta problemas hasta la version 1.2.3.10264, despues sale el mensaje que indico, no tengo idea porque ... gracias

Re: Problemas con nuevas versiones de xHarbour y BCC

PostPosted: Sat Mar 23, 2024 3:47 pm
by Enrico Maria Giordano
You have to ask the author of that library to rebuild it with the new xHarbour build. This is the problem in using third party libraries.

Re: Problemas con nuevas versiones de xHarbour y BCC

PostPosted: Sat Mar 23, 2024 4:14 pm
by Enrrique Vertiz
Ok Enrico, entiendo entonces que la solucion pasa por construir la LIB con la nueva version de xHb, gracias ...

Re: Problemas con nuevas versiones de xHarbour y BCC

PostPosted: Sat Mar 23, 2024 10:42 pm
by Antonio Linares
Estimado Enrique,

> Da error: FWH 24.02, xHarbour 1.2.3.10279, BCC 7.4 (el error aqui abajo)

Tienes que usar bcc 7.70

Re: Problemas con nuevas versiones de xHarbour y BCC

PostPosted: Sun Mar 24, 2024 4:14 am
by Enrrique Vertiz
Saludos Antonio

Gracias por tu informacion, baje y compile con BCC77, pero ahi no llega a linkear, se detiene en todos los .PRG que tienen codigo C en la parte final, se detiene pero sin arrojar error, por eso no tengo que pasar por aqui, y por eso digo que me extraña q con xHb 123.10264 y BCC 74 si compila y enlaza sin problemas.
Probare con versiones siguientes a ver si consigo algun mensaje de error que pueda compartir.

Re: Problemas con nuevas versiones de xHarbour y BCC

PostPosted: Sun Mar 24, 2024 5:38 am
by Antonio Linares
Enrique,

Este ejemplo construye bien:
Code: Select all  Expand view
#include "FiveWin.ch"

function Main()

   ? Test()

return nil

#pragma BEGINDUMP

#include <hbapi.h>

HB_FUNC( TEST )
{
   hb_retc( "Hello world" );
}

#pragma ENDDUMP
 

Puedes proporcionar un ejemplo que falle ? gracias

Re: Problemas con nuevas versiones de xHarbour y BCC

PostPosted: Sun Mar 24, 2024 6:21 pm
by Enrrique Vertiz
Saludos Antonio

En limpio probe con este codigo y compila sin problemas, debe existir algo en el entorno completo de mi aplicacion y todas las LIBs q cargo que da el error, voy a reproducirlo a ver si puedo mostrarlo
Gracias